British Book Trade and Spanish American Independence

Discover the intricate relationship between the British book trade and the emergence of national identities in early-independent Spanish America in the compelling work, British Book Trade and Spanish American Independence by Taylor & Francis Ltd. Published in 2003, this insightful study spans 304 pages, delving into the multifaceted aspects of book exportation from Britain to Spanish America.

Explore the entire process of production, distribution, and the transformative journey of British literature as it was read and re-written in the region. This book offers a unique perspective on how literature influenced the cultural and national landscapes of Spanish America during a pivotal historical period.
